如何找出从批处理文件安装 MSI 失败的原因?

问题描述 投票:0回答:0

我有一个应该安装 MSI 包的批处理文件。

`msiexec /i "%~dp0Client.msi" SERVERURL="https://server" WSUSERDIR=%appdata%\Program\users" /quiet`

我以管理员身份执行它,cmd 打开,但它没有安装软件。没有任何反馈。

这个答案之后,我添加了

pushd %~dp0
start /wait msiexec /i "Client.msi" SERVERURL="https://server" WSUSERDIR=%appdata%\Program\users" /quiet

我试过像

Call msiexec.exe 
start "" "msiexec..."
这样的变化。

我之前已经成功地从 Batch 安装了 MSI,但我不明白这里有什么不同。 我如何找出它不执行的原因? 代码有什么问题吗?

batch-file windows-installer
© www.soinside.com 2019 - 2024. All rights reserved.